The IPL 2025 season opener is set for March 22 at Eden Gardens, Kolkata, featuring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R) and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B). This historic matchup revisits their 2008 inaugural face-off, promising an exciting start to the season. With KKR’s home advantage and RCB’s revamped spin attack led by Krunal Pandya, the match is poised for intense competition. Following the excitement surrounding the IPL 2025 season opener between KKR and RCB, weather concerns have emerged in Kolkata. The forecast indicates overcast conditions with occasional showers, potentially impacting the match. Accuweather.com predicts a mix of cloudy weather and potential showers, particularly from Friday evening through Saturday morning. Morning precipitation is expected, with a gradual improvement in the afternoon, reducing rain chances to 25% by evening.

With rain threatening the KKR vs RCB opener, delays are likely. The match may be shortened to a minimum of five overs per side to achieve a result. If conditions don’t improve, the game could face postponement.
If the second team can’t complete five overs after the extra hour, the match will be declared a “no result.” Each team would receive one point in the group stage.
IPL regulations allow an additional hour after the scheduled end time for the team batting second to complete their innings. This provision aims to maximize the chances of achieving a result despite weather interruptions.

Following potential disruptions due to rain in Kolkata, KKR’s focus shifts to their upcoming fixture against Rajasthan Royals in Guwahati. This match will be crucial for KKR to establish momentum early in the IPL 2025 season, especially with their new captain Ajinkya Rahane at the helm. Meanwhile, RCB faces a challenging encounter against Chennai Super Kings in Chennai, testing their revamped squad under Rajat Patidar’s leadership. The Dhaka Premier Division Cricket League (DPDCL) has faced recent disruptions, with the 40th and 41st matches being abandoned due to unfavourable weather conditions. These cancellations highlight the impact of external factors on cricket schedules, mirroring the potential challenges faced by the IPL 2025 opener.
In a thrilling encounter, PSC secured a narrow one-wicket victory over Agran in the 42nd match of the DPDCL. This nail-biting finish showcases the competitive nature of the league and the high-stakes cricket being played in the region.
